Nail polish colors and trends continuously change, like the weather. Within the past year, a few trends have painted their polish to stay for good.
Gel polish, art design and neutral colors are among the few that are the ultimate craze at the moment.
A gel polish manicure lasts for about two weeks, without chipping or cracking and stays shiny the entire time.
Although it is very popular and trendy at the moment, many women do not know all the risks involved with receiving a gel manicure.
In order for gel nail polish to work, you have to place your hands under a UV lamp at various times during the manicure, for up to eight minutes.
“The lengthy dose of UV light used to dry the gel is known to damage skin cells much in the same way as tanning beds,” states Dr. Chris Adigun of NYU Langone Medical Center.
“I know there are risks with gel manicures, but I like them better because they last longer than regular polish,” explains student Kirsten Ukkestad.

Other than gel polish and art design, the classic painted nail is always in style.
OPI is famous for their unique polish names, and always on-trend polish colors.
Each season OPI is inspired by a current event or popular attraction. The Spring 2013 OPI collection is inspired by Disney’s Oz the Great and Powerful movie.
With a total of six colors in the collection, you can see that pales, neutrals and glitters are the go-to colors for the spring season.
With names like, ‘When Monkey’s Fly!” and “Glints of Glinda,” who wouldn’t want to apply the mystical polishes to their nails?
